Musk moves SpaceX headquarters from California to Texas

Washington: The headquarters of US private aerospace company SpaceX will be moved to the new city of Starbase in Texas from California, owner Elon Musk said on Friday.

Musk made a repost on X with the text of a letter that SpaceX had sent to a local judge requesting an election to give its Starbase construction and space launch site in south Texas the status of a separate city. The base was reportedly home to several hundred of the company’s employees.

“SpaceX HQ will now officially be in the city of Starbase, Texas!,” Musk said on X.

SpaceX has multi-billion-dollar contracts with the Pentagon and NASA.
